•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录

奋斗的软件工程师

  • 博客园
  • 联系
  • 订阅
  • 管理

公告

上一页 1 ··· 13 14 15 16 17 18 19 下一页

2024年1月30日

采用LinkedList设计栈和队列

摘要: LinkedList集合的底层原理 基于双链表实现的。 特点:查询慢,增删相对较快,但对首尾元素进行增删改查的速度是极快的。 public void addFirst​(E e) public void addLast​(E e) public E getFirst​() public E getL 阅读全文

posted @ 2024-01-30 22:34 周政然 阅读(16) 评论(0) 推荐(0)

2024年1月29日

Java中,遍历List集合有以下四种方式

摘要: 1.增强for循环(foreach):这种方式是最简单的,也是最易读的。它直接对集合中的每个元素进行操作,不需要额外的迭代器或索引变量。但是,这种方式不能在遍历过程中修改集合的结构(例如添加或删除元素)。 2.使用迭代器:迭代器提供了一种通用的遍历集合的方式,可以在遍历过程中修改集合的结构。但是,使 阅读全文

posted @ 2024-01-29 23:08 周政然 阅读(788) 评论(0) 推荐(0)

java中二分查找前提必须是升序吗?

摘要: 二分查找不必须是升序,降序排列的数组也可以执行二分查找。 二分查找算法是一种高效的搜索方法,它要求数据集是有序的,无论是升序还是降序都可以。在升序排列的情况下,算法会将目标值与中间值比较,如果目标值较小,则在左半部分继续查找;如果目标值较大,则在右半部分继续查找。在降序排列的情况下,比较逻辑相反 点 阅读全文

posted @ 2024-01-29 13:07 周政然 阅读(46) 评论(0) 推荐(0)

2024年1月27日

自定义对象比较器,结果失真怎么办?

摘要: 如果自定义对象比较器的结果失真,那么首先需要确认比较器的compare方法是否正确实现。在Java中,compare方法应该返回一个负整数、零或正整数,分别表示第一个参数小于、等于或大于第二个参数。 例如,如果我们正在比较两个Student对象,我们可能会根据他们的身高或年龄来排序。但是,如果我们的 阅读全文

posted @ 2024-01-27 14:44 周政然 阅读(41) 评论(0) 推荐(0)

给定时间 2023年09月10日 在此时间上,加一个月

摘要: 点击查看代码 package com.sleepman.pers; import java.text.ParseException; import java.text.SimpleDateFormat; import java.time.LocalDate; import java.time.for 阅读全文

posted @ 2024-01-27 14:04 周政然 阅读(44) 评论(0) 推荐(0)

2023年11月16日

JavaSE day07.08.-Exception、Lambda表达式、Stream流[测评题]

摘要: 选择题 题目1(单选): 在下列选项中选出编译时期异常( ) 选项 : ​ A. ArrayIndexOutOfBoundsException ​ B. NullPointerException ​ C. ClassCastException ​ D. ParseException 题目2(多选): 阅读全文

posted @ 2023-11-16 14:50 周政然 阅读(36) 评论(0) 推荐(0)

JavaSE day08 - Lambda,Stream,File,递归

摘要: JavaSE day08 - Lambda,Stream,File,递归 今日目标 Lambda表达式 Stream流 File类 递归 1 Lambda表达式 1.1 体验Lambda表达式 package com.itheima.lambda_demo; /* Lambda表达式体验 : */ 阅读全文

posted @ 2023-11-16 14:14 周政然 阅读(26) 评论(0) 推荐(0)

JavaSE day07-异常,多线程

摘要: JavaSE day07-异常,多线程 今日目标 : 异常的概述 异常的分类 异常的处理方式 自定义异常 多线程入门 1 异常的概述 1.1 什么是异常? 异常就是程序出现了不正常情况 , 程序在执行过程中 , 数据导致程序不正常 , 最终导致了JVM的非正常停止 注意 : 语句错误不算在异常体系中 阅读全文

posted @ 2023-11-16 14:11 周政然 阅读(25) 评论(0) 推荐(0)

2023年11月13日

JavaSE Collection&Test on Git

摘要: JavaSE Collection&Test on Git Hello World 阅读全文

posted @ 2023-11-13 21:43 周政然 阅读(16) 评论(0) 推荐(0)

JavaSE Colloection

摘要: JavaSE Colloection List ArrayList ArrayListDemo1 点击查看代码 import java.util.ArrayList; import java.util.Collection; import java.util.Iterator; class Arra 阅读全文

posted @ 2023-11-13 18:44 周政然 阅读(30) 评论(0) 推荐(0)

上一页 1 ··· 13 14 15 16 17 18 19 下一页
 
博客园  ©  2004-2025
浙公网安备 33010602011771号 浙ICP备2021040463号-3